Sourcing guidance for Open Ear Earbud
What are the key technical specifications to consider when sourcing Open Ear Earbuds?
When evaluating Open Ear Earbuds, prioritize Air Conduction or Bone Conduction technology. For air conduction models, ensure they feature Directional Sound Technology to minimize sound leakage. Key specs include Bluetooth 5.3 or higher for stable connectivity, a battery life of at least 7-10 hours per charge, and an IPX5 or higher waterproof rating to ensure durability against sweat and rain during outdoor use.
Which compliance standards and certifications are mandatory for international markets?
For the US market, products must have FCC certification and comply with UL 62368-1 for battery safety. For the EU, CE marking (RED directive) and RoHS compliance are mandatory to ensure the absence of hazardous substances. Additionally, ensure the lithium batteries have UN38.3 and MSDS reports to facilitate legal and safe international shipping.
How can I verify the audio quality and leakage control of a supplier's product?
Request a third-party acoustic test report focusing on the Frequency Response Curve and Total Harmonic Distortion (THD). To test sound leakage, ask the supplier for a video demonstration or a sample to conduct a decibel test at a 30cm distance; high-quality open-ear buds should maintain privacy even at 70% volume. Look for suppliers using Dual-mic ENC (Environmental Noise Cancellation) for clear voice calls.
What are the common usage scenarios that drive demand for this product?
Open Ear Earbuds are primarily targeted at outdoor athletes (runners and cyclists) who need situational awareness for safety. They are also increasingly popular in office environments where employees need to remain approachable, and for users with sensitive ear canals who find traditional in-ear buds uncomfortable. Highlighting ergonomic ear-hook designs that prevent ear fatigue is a major selling point.
Cross-Border Procurement Strategy & Risk Management
How can I mitigate the risks of receiving defective electronic goods?
Implement a strict Quality Control (QC) protocol. Always hire a third-party inspection service (like V-Trust or QIMA) to perform a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I). Focus on battery cycle tests, Bluetooth pairing stability, and physical stress tests on the ear hooks. Never release the final 70% balance payment until the inspection report is approved.
What are the best practices for negotiating with Chinese electronics suppliers?
Focus on Tiered Pricing based on volume; for orders over 2,000 units, aim for a 10-15% discount. Negotiate for 1-2% spare units (FOC - Free of Charge) to cover potential RMAs. What shipping methods are recommended for products containing lithium batteries?
Since earbuds contain lithium batteries, they are classified as Dangerous Goods (DG). For small batches, use Air Express (DHL/FedEx) with proper DG labeling. For bulk orders, Sea Freight (LCL/FCL) is most cost-effective, but ensure the forwarder is experienced in Class 9 hazardous materials handling. Always confirm the Incoterms; FOB (Free On Board) is recommended for better control over shipping costs.
How do I ensure transaction security during the procurement process?
Utilize Secured Payment services provided by reputable platforms like Made-in-China.com to ensure your funds are held in escrow until delivery is confirmed. Avoid direct wire transfers to private bank accounts. Ensure the Proforma Invoice (PI) clearly states the detailed product specifications, lead time, and warranty terms (ideally 12 months).
